MINISTER for Sport & Tourisism Patrick OโDonovan will officially launch the 2017 Season Ticket campaignย for Limerick GAA this Thursday evening in the Woodlands House Hotel Adare, at 9pm.
The 2017 season ticket, which raises funds for the development of the Limerick team, allows entry to all Limerick County Board Club games in 2017 as well as affording the option to purchase an All Ireland Senior Hurling Final Ticket (if Limerick Senior Hurling team is involved).

The launch of the GAA season tickets comes after the Limerick county board unveiled the new look Limerick GAA jersey for 2017. The jersey, pictured above, was selected by fans of Limerick GAA through a social media poll. The jersey will be on view throughout the National League campaigns, as well as the championship in the summer of 2017.
Speaking of the championship, John Kielyโโs senior hurling side will face Clare on Sunday June 4 in Thurles. Should Limerick advance in that game, they will play the Munster final on July 9.
On the football front, the Limerick senior footballers, under Billy Lee, will take on Clare also on the weekend of May 27/28 in Ennis.ย The winners will play Kerry in the semi-final on June 10/11, with the 2017 Munster SFC Final on Sunday July 2.
